[Remote] Financial Aid Systems & Operations Analyst

100% Remote Full-time Open now

Note: The job is a remote job and is open to candidates in USA. The University of Scranton is a Catholic and Jesuit university dedicated to the formation of students. They are seeking a Financial Aid Systems & Operations Analyst to support the administration and optimization of financial aid systems, ensuring compliance and operational accuracy across various programs.

Responsibilities

  • Administer and coordinate the Banner Financial Aid module, including system configuration, implementation, testing, documentation, and training
  • Coordinate annual aid-year setup processes, including roll procedures, parameter updates, table configuration, and system validation for regulatory compliance
  • Manage financial aid system operations, including electronic data loads, file transmissions, and data exchanges with the U.S. Department of Education, state agencies, and other external partners – Configure, test, run, and support automated and manual financial aid packaging processes within Banner, ensuring awarding methodologies align with institutional policy, federal regulations, and enrollment management objectives
  • Serve as the primary functional subject matter expert for Banner Financial Aid and related ERP platforms, supporting system functionality, optimization, and compliance
  • Monitor, research, and implement system updates, including Banner releases, regulatory changes, patches, and enhancements
  • Collaborate with Information Technology on system integrations, job scheduling, automation workflows, and enterprise process improvements
  • Diagnose and resolve system issues in partnership with IT staff and external vendors to ensure continuity of operations
  • Maintain data integrity across financial aid systems, identifying discrepancies and implementing corrective actions
  • Ensure compliance with federal, state, and institutional financial aid regulations through system configuration and operational controls
  • Develop, maintain, and distribute operational, management, and compliance reports using Banner, Argos, and related reporting tools
  • Support internal audits, program reviews, reconciliations, and compliance monitoring activities
  • Develop and maintain system documentation, procedural guides, and updates to the Financial Aid Policy and Procedure Manual
